The Boston Beer Company is America's leading brewer of handcrafted, full-flavored craft beers. Founder and brewer, Jim Koch, brews Samuel Adams craft beers using the time honored traditional four-vessel brewing process, and the world's finest all-natural ingredients. With over 30 distinctive, award-winning styles of craft beer, Samuel Adams offers discerning beer drinkers a variety of brews. The brewery has won more awards in international beer tasting competitions in the last five years than any other craft beer brewery in the world. Koch uses his great-great grandfather Louis Koch's recipe that he made at his brewery in St. Louis, Missouri in the 1870s. Koch founded The Boston Beer Company in 1984 and the following spring, Koch filled his old consulting briefcase with bottles from his sample brew and started going door to door asking Boston bars and restaurants to serve the beer that he had named Samuel Adams Boston Lager. He chose that name because Samuel Adams was a Boston firebrand, a revolutionary thinker who fought for independence. Most importantly, Samuel Adams was also a brewer who had inherited a brewing tradition from his father. In April 1985, when Samuel Adams Boston Lager made its debut in about 25 bars and restaurants in Boston, the company had no office, no computers, and no distributors. Today there are over 1,200 employees and Sam Adams is available in 50 states and 20 foreign Countries. Since 1882, Doyle's Cafe remains one of Boston's favorite bars and family restaurants.
